TyreKicker: A user forum for all your car questions

Tyrekicker.net is a forum exclusively for cars. Are you having car trouble, is your BMW always breaking down or perhaps your Land Rover is not driving well, what ever your car problem, why not post a question and have one of our car experts forum answer it for you...we can fix all kinds of car issues, from Japanese car problems, French car problems, German car issues and American / Italian too. Join today, it's free.